Aims

To assess the response of six barley varieties treated with five different N rates at sowing.

Key messages
  • When the maximum rate of nitrogen (N) was applied, La Trobe achieved malt grade and the greatest profitability.
  • Fathom was the most N efficient variety, converting the most supplied nitrogen to grain, whereas Compass and Commander were the least responsive.
  • The highest rate of N (120kg N/ha) was the most profitable for all varieties in a Decile 10 growing season

Method

Crop type Cereal (Grain): Barley
Treatment type(s)
  • Fertiliser: Rate
Trial type Experimental
Trial design Randomised,Replicated,Blocked

Quambatook 2016

Sow rate or Target density 140 plants/m²
Sowing machinery

Knife points, press wheels, 30cm row spacing

Sow date 16 May 2016
Harvest date Yield analysis in this report is from samples collected at maturity on 15 November. The trial was ha
Plot size Not specified
Plot replication 4
Fertiliser

Nitrogen as per treatment list in trial details.

Herbicide

18 May          Glyphosate @ 2L/ha + Trifluralin @ 1.5L/ha + Avadex® @ 2L/ha (at sowing)
7 July            Affinity Force® @ 100mL/ha + Thistle Killem® @ 330mL/ha + LontrelTM Advanced @ 100mL/ha
20 July          Axial® @ 300mL/ha + Hasten @ 0.5% (GS30)
26 August      Velocity® @ 670mL/ha + Lontrel 300 @ 100mL/ha + MCPA LVE @ 500mL/ha + UptakeTM @ 0.5%

Insecticide

20 September         LorsbanTM 500 EC @ 200 mL/ha + Genwet 1000 @ 0.25%

Fungicide

20 July                Propicon® 550 EC @ 230mL/ha (GS30)
20 September      Prosaro® 420 SC @ 300mL/ha

Trial results Table 1

# Variety
Treatment 1
Protein (%) Establishment plants (plants/m2) Grain yield (t/ha)
1 Commander 0 Nkg/ha 6.8 161 3.1
2 Commander 30 Nkg/ha 6.3 3.8
3 Commander 60 Nkg/ha 7.3 4.1
4 Commander 90 Nkg/ha 7.9 4.8
5 Commander 120 Nkg/ha 8 5.4
6 Compass 0 Nkg/ha 7.3 160 3
7 Compass 30 Nkg/ha 7.5 3.7
8 Compass 60 Nkg/ha 7.4 4.2
9 Compass 90 Nkg/ha 8.2 4.5
10 Compass 120 Nkg/ha 8.9 5.4
11 Fathom 0 Nkg/ha 7.9 154 3.2
12 Fathom 30 Nkg/ha 7.9 4.3
13 Fathom 60 Nkg/ha 8.7 5.5
14 Fathom 90 Nkg/ha 8.4 6.2
15 Fathom 120 Nkg/ha 9.5 6.6
16 Granger 0 Nkg/ha 6.3 133 3.8
17 Granger 30 Nkg/ha 6.7 4.5
18 Granger 60 Nkg/ha 7.3 5.7
19 Granger 90 Nkg/ha 7.9 5.1
20 Granger 120 Nkg/ha 8.6 6.2
21 La Trobe 0 Nkg/ha 7 152 3.3
22 La Trobe 30 Nkg/ha 7.4 3.8
23 La Trobe 60 Nkg/ha 7.9 4.9
24 La Trobe 90 Nkg/ha 8.2 5.5
25 La Trobe 120 Nkg/ha 9.2 6.7
26 Scope CL 0 Nkg/ha 7.2 152 3.1
27 Scope CL 30 Nkg/ha 6.6 3.6
28 Scope CL 60 Nkg/ha 7.3 4.6
29 Scope CL 90 Nkg/ha 8.2 5.2
30 Scope CL 120 Nkg/ha 9 5.3
